So, Muscle (1989) is this unsettling blend of drama, horror, and thriller that really dives into the darker aspects of desire and obsession. The film features Ryuzaki, an editor at Muscle Magazine, who gets caught up in a twisted affair with Kitami. Their relationship spirals into these sadomasochistic games that are both provocative and haunting. After a year in jail, Ryuzaki's quest to find Kitami unfolds with a sense of dread that keeps you on edge. The pacing feels deliberate; it’s almost methodical, mirroring the tension of the story. What really stands out are the raw performances and some practical effects that create a gritty atmosphere. It’s not your standard fare, and that’s what makes it distinctive.
